Is there a park and ride option in Northland?

While Russell itself does not have a dedicated park and ride service, nearby towns in Northland do offer convenient options. For example, you can park in Paihia and take a ferry to Russell, which also allows you to enjoy the scenic views of the Bay of Islands without worrying about parking hassles.
